JOB DESCRIPTION
The Strategic Project Lead will partner closely with senior leaders and cross-functional stakeholders to support strategic decision-making across business units. This role blends financial analysis and strategic thinking to evaluate business performance, inform long-term planning, and develop data-driven recommendations that supports operational and strategic objectives. The ideal candidate brings a strong analytical foundation, experience from investment banking or management consulting, and the ability to translate complex financial information into clear, compelling insights for executive audiences.
Required skills and experience:
3+ years of professional experience in investment banking, management consulting, corporate strategy, or a related, analytical role. Bachelor degree in Finance, Economics, Accounting or a related, quantitative field Strong foundational knowledge of Financial Planning & Analysis concepts, including budgeting, forecasting, and variance analysis Demonstrates strong numerical, analytical, and problem-solving skill with an ability to synthesize fundings for an executive audience Excellent written and verbal communication skills Proven ability to work collaboratively in a team-based environment, but also the ability to lead projects and operate independently when needed Strong project and time management skills, especially an ability to handle competing priorities effectively Nice-to-Have skills and experience: Prior experience with a large investment management, asset management, or financial services firm Experience building dashboards, financial reports, or data visualizations with Power BI, Tableau, or similar tools Basic to intermediate coding or data manipulation skills (e.g., SQL, Python, advanced Excel) Exposure to cost management, operational finance, or enterprise-wide strategic initiatives
